What are some ways we can get more out of Sunday worship?  Here are a few simple answers:

  • Pray.  Ask God now to prepare the hearts of all who will gather, and to give joy and wisdom to those preparing and leading the service in different ways.  Ask Michaela who the Children’s Church workers are so you can pray for those volunteers.    
  • Begin praying today for those you will be worshiping with — those who currently make up our Crossroads family, and those who may be visiting or new.
  • Arrive early Sunday morning.  You’ll have a chance to enter into the joy of the morning, or a chance to quiet your heart for a few minutes and set aside the cares and burdens of life.  You’ll encourage newcomers and regular members by being there to welcome them.
  • Read Sunday’s Scripture ahead of time (for this coming Sunday, Revelation 2:1-17).   
  • On Thursday or Friday, text or email Heather Hall and ask her what songs we’ll be singing.  (Heather prepares the worship slides each week, so she’ll know and would be happy to tell you!)  By familiarizing yourself with Sunday’s songs, your heart and voice will be better able to enter into singing.
  • Almost every Sunday, some from Crossroads eat out together after the service.  Plan to join them.  Just ask around where people are going.  If you’re going home after the service, consider inviting someone to join you or your family.  Over lunch, share a way God spoke to you during the service.

Regular worship is much like eating regular meals.  You may not remember many of the meals you eat, but because you regularly take in nourishment, you stay in good health, grow physically, and feel good!

All the All’s

It was a blessing to have Lawson and Shay Albey with us last Sunday!  They have around 80% of the financial and prayer support they’re looking for in order to leave for the ministry God has called them to in Ankara, Turkey.  Imagine:  Ankara, a city of 6 million people, and only 15 churches!  Here’s a very brief summary of Lawson’s sermon from Matthew 28:18-20, Jesus’ commission to His disciples to go to all nations:

1.  All authority.  We follow the Lord’s command to make disciples because He has commissioned us.  He possesses authority and is our commander-in-chief.

2.  All nations.  The word “nations” in the Matthew 28 passage is from a Greek word that perhaps more accurately means “ethnicities.”  We’re to reach all people groups, both near and far.

3.  All that He commanded.  Our message should include a call to obedience.  The Lord’s own summary of His commandments was to love God with all our heart, soul, mind and strength, and to love our neighbors as ourselves. (Matthew 22:37-40).

4.  Always.  He is with us always, no matter where we go.
